BC414 Explained: How to Efficiently Program Database Updates

BC414 Explained: How to Efficiently Program Database Updates

Database updates are the lifeline of any durable application. They make certain that your data continues to be accurate, appropriate, and enhanced for performance. However allow's face it: updating a data source can be an overwhelming job. It's not almost going into new info; it includes meticulous planning and implementation to avoid mistakes that could cause major problems down the line.If you're in London and aiming to raise your skills in this area, you might have heard of BC414-- Programming Database Updates training course london. This program focuses on gearing up designers with the understanding they need to deal with database updates effectively and effectively.Whether you're a seasoned designer or just starting, comprehending how to navigate the complexities of database updates is crucial for your success. web Let's dive deeper into what makes these processes testing and discover some tools and techniques that can assist simplify them! Understanding Database Updates Data source updates are necessary for maintaining the honesty of your data. They incorporate a range of jobs, varying from

placing new records to modifying existing info. Each update lugs significant implications for application performance and customer experience.At its core, an efficient database upgrade needs a clear understanding of the underlying structure. This includes recognizing how tables associate with one another and acknowledging the restrictions that control information entrance. Moreover, it's crucial to take into consideration purchase administration throughout updates. Guaranteeing that adjustments are atomic methods either all modifications take place or none do-- this helps guard against partial updates that can corrupt your dataset.As systems expand more complex, so does the requirement for mindful preparation in executing these updates. Being proactive can save time and sources while enhancing total system reliability as you browse through evolving company needs.

Common Challenges in Database Updates Database updates can frequently feel like browsing a minefield. One common challenge is guaranteeing data stability. When multiple users attempt to update the exact same document, disputes develop, leading to prospective loss of crucial information.Another concern is downtime during updates. Companies depend

on real-time data access, and any type of disruption can interfere with procedures. Striking an equilibrium in between needed updates and preserving availability is essential.Moreover, compatibility problems with existing systems often appear. New software or data source versions may not align completely with older applications, complicating the update process.Security vulnerabilities also posture considerable dangers during data source adjustments. Every update opens doors that could be exploited otherwise managed very carefully. Ensuring robust security procedures are in place helps alleviate these dangers while maintaining data safe.Insufficient documentation commonly leads to confusion among staff member when carrying out updates. Clear guidelines can reduce misunderstandings and enhance processes for

everybody entailed. Tools and Techniques for Streamlining Database Updates When it concerns streamlining database updates, having the right devices and techniques is crucial. Automation can conserve a great deal of time. Devices like SQL scripts permit set processing, allowing you to carry out

many updates quickly.Using version control systems aids track adjustments successfully. By doing this, you make sure that every update is recorded and relatively easy to fix if required. Code testimonial methods also play a substantial duty in preserving

quality and consistency throughout your database updates.Monitoring tools are necessary as they supply insights right into performance issues after updates are carried out. Watching on resource usage and action times helps prepare for possible troubles before they escalate.Moreover, training plays a fundamental part in this procedure. An all-round team knowledgeable about finest methods will definitely boost effectiveness in handling database tasks. Enlisting in specialized programs such as BC414-- Programming Database Updates course London can outfit professionals with beneficial abilities tailored specifically for these challenges.Combining the right techniques with constant discovering leads the way for smoother experiences when managing data source updates.